Market Leaders in Energy & Environmental corporate finance

Around the world, countries and companies are faced with the need to reduce exposure to volatile energy prices and greenhouse gas emissions, and improve energy security of supply. Energy users, utilities, independent project developers and investors are presented with a wide range of opportunities in the renewable energy sector, underpinned by renewable energy regulatory regimes to support investment and ambitious targets to reduce emissions.

We work with many businesses and Governments worldwide to address the renewable energy issues of today and anticipate those of tomorrow. Our experience spans over more than 15 years and has included onshore and offshore wind, a wide range of solar technologies, biomass, geothermal, marine technology, energy from waste, coal mine methane and carbon capture and storage. We have also advised on renewable heat and renewable fuel for transport projects.

With our in-depth understanding of renewable energy technology and regulation, our significant experience, scale and global reach, we are ideally placed to help our clients tackle the challenges and seize the opportunities presented by the developing renewable energy market.

Renewable energy attractiveness indices: November 2012

Our latest Renewable Energy Country Attractiveness Indices reflects Q3 developments and sees high hopes for the Energy Bill as the UK’s attractiveness for renewable energy investment falters.

Global cleantech insights and trends report 2012

How is the transformation toward a resource efficient and low-carbon economy driving cleantech? Gain insight into the global agenda through our interviews, articles and more.

Cleantech Ireland

'Cleantech Ireland’ is Ernst & Young’s inaugural report on Ireland’s cleantech sector. The report has identified a number of key insights into the cleantech sector in Ireland and the significant potential that the sector can bring to the economy in terms of competitiveness, job creation and growth.

Applying IFRS in the solar industry

This guide aims to address the challenges of IFRS accounting in the solar technology industry. It provides insights on common IFRS issues relevant to your business and related accounting guidance.
